黑龙江省玉米种植户黑土地保护利用技术采纳行为的影响因素研究

通过对黑龙江省6个市级地区的298份调研数据进行整理,分别从个人特征、家庭特征、认知特征和政策特征4个方面进行描述性统计分析.基于农业可持续发展理论、农户行为理论和生态经济理论,结合描述性统计分析结果,最终选取年龄、受教育程度、耕地质量等15个指标,运用二元probit回归模型进行实证分析.结果表明,玉米种植户的受教育程度、劳动力数量、是否了解黑土地保护政策等11个指标通过了显著性检验,玉米种植户的耕地质量对其采纳行为存在负向影响,其余10个指标均对其采纳行为存在正向影响,其中,玉米种植户的受教育程度、是否满意秸秆还田补贴金额、是否满意少耕免耕补贴金额、是否满意粮食轮作补贴金额在1%水平上显著,是其采纳黑土地保护利用技术的深层次影响因素.基于上述研究,从健全黑土地保护利用技术推广体系、完善黑土地保护利用技术相关政策、加强黑土地保护利用技术宣传力度3个方面提出相关政策建议.
Study on the Influencing Factors of Corn Farmers'Adoption Behavior of Black Land Conservation Technology in Heilongjiang Province
By organizing 298 survey data from 6 municipal areas in Heilongjiang Province,descriptive statisti-cal analysis was conducted from four aspects:personal characteristics,family characteristics,cognitive characteris-tics,and policy characteristics.Based on the theory of agricultural sustainable Development theory,the theory of farmers'behavior and the theory of ecological economy,combined with the results of descriptive statistical analysis,15 indicators such as age,education level and cultivated land quality were finally selected for empirical analysis us-ing the binary probit regression model.The results showed that 11 indicators,including education level,labor force quantity,understanding of black land protection policies,and subsidies,of corn growers passed the significance test.The quality of arable land of corn growers had a negative impact on their adoption behavior,while the other 10 indi-cators had a positive impact on their adoption behavior.Among them,the education level of corn growers,whether they are satisfied with straw return,less tillage and no tillage The significant subsidy amount for grain rotation at the 1%level is a deep-seated influencing factor for its adoption of black land protection and utilization technology.Based on the above research,this article proposes relevant policy recommendations from three aspects:improving the technology promotion system,improving technology related policies,and strengthening technology promotion ef-forts.
